Postino Pat - Il film is a British-Italian 3D computer-animated comedy that brings the beloved BBC Children's character to the big screen. At its core, the film delivers a moral message about success: "If the people you love aren't here to share your success, maybe you're not successful after all" . Critics noted the "edgier" feel compared to the show, featuring tracking shots through Greendale and action sequences involving threatening robots.
